Consumer Financial Whistleblower Incentives and Protection Act.

This act establishes a program to reward and protect individuals who report violations of consumer financial law. Citizens can receive a portion of recovered funds if their information leads to successful enforcement actions against companies. This aims to encourage reporting of fraud and unfair practices, potentially enhancing financial security for everyone.
Key points
Whistleblowers reporting consumer financial law violations can receive 10% to 30% of collected monetary sanctions, up to $5 million.
Information must be original and not previously known to the Bureau to qualify for an award.
The act protects whistleblower identity unless disclosure is required in a public proceeding.
Awards are denied to individuals involved in the violation or those who provide false information.
